Transaction 884fe77842d36992e7a0c4cc921991e84a900658a591b9ee5ac70e51ed66bb76
1 Input
1 Output
-
884fe77842d36992e7a0c4cc921991e84a900658a591b9ee5ac70e51ed66bb76:0
- value
- 1081494
- script pubkey
- OP_0 OP_PUSHBYTES_20 9939707114e633948425968bab0c387403972e61
- address
- bc1qnyuhqug5uceefpp9j696krpcwspewtnpx9w982